Are there any risks involved in arbitrage trading on Bithumb for digital currencies?

What are the potential risks associated with engaging in arbitrage trading on Bithumb for digital currencies? How likely are these risks to occur and what measures can be taken to mitigate them?

- saeid pooyaOct 25, 2022 · 3 years agoArbitrage trading on Bithumb for digital currencies does come with certain risks. One of the main risks is price volatility. Digital currencies are known for their price fluctuations, and this can affect the profitability of arbitrage trades. Additionally, there is the risk of technical issues or glitches on the Bithumb platform, which can lead to delays or errors in executing trades. It's also important to consider the risk of regulatory changes or legal issues that may impact the availability or legality of certain digital currencies. To mitigate these risks, it is advisable to carefully monitor market conditions, use reliable trading tools, and diversify your trading strategies.
- GaneshneelakantamApr 25, 2024 · a year agoYes, there are risks involved in arbitrage trading on Bithumb for digital currencies. One potential risk is the counterparty risk, which refers to the risk of the other party involved in the trade defaulting or failing to fulfill their obligations. Another risk is the liquidity risk, where there may not be enough buyers or sellers at the desired price to execute the arbitrage trade. It's also important to consider the risk of hacking or security breaches on the Bithumb platform, which can result in the loss of funds. To minimize these risks, it is recommended to conduct thorough research, use reputable exchanges, and implement proper security measures such as two-factor authentication.

Market conditions can change rapidly, and there is always the risk of price discrepancies between different exchanges. It's important to note that arbitrage opportunities may be short-lived and may require quick execution. Additionally, there is the risk of transaction fees and slippage, which can eat into the profits of arbitrage trades. To mitigate these risks, it is crucial to stay updated with market trends, use advanced trading tools, and carefully calculate the potential profits and costs involved in each arbitrage trade.
